Here are some of the sample sentences I go through in the podcast:
Öffne die Datei!
(Open the file!)
Open the file!
Öffne den Ordner!
(Open the folder!)
Open the folder!
Ich habe die Datei geöffnet.
(I have the file opened.)
I’ve opened the file.
Ich habe den Ordner geöffnet.
(I have the folder opened.)
I’ve opened the folder.
Nachdem du die Datei geöffnet hast, kopiere das Bild.
(After you the file opened have, copy the picture.)
After you’ve opened the file, copy the picture.
Nachdem du den Ordner geöffnet hast, kopiere die Datei.
(After you the folder opened have, copy the file.)
After you’ve opened the folder, copy the file.
